Elastography imaging is a non-invasive diagnostic technique that evaluates tissue stiffness to detect and monitor various medical conditions. This imaging method helps differentiate between healthy and diseased tissues by measuring their response to mechanical pressure. It is primarily used in diagnosing liver fibrosis, tumors, and musculoskeletal disorders, among other conditions. The technology is integrated into ultrasound and magnetic resonance imaging (MRI) systems, allowing healthcare providers to obtain real-time insights into tissue elasticity. By enhancing diagnostic accuracy and reducing the need for invasive biopsies, elastography imaging has become a crucial tool in modern medical diagnostics. Elastography Imaging Market Report Highlights

  • By modality, ultrasound dominates the elastography imaging market due to its wide application in diagnosing liver fibrosis, tumors, and musculoskeletal disorders. The cost-effectiveness, real-time imaging capabilities, and ease of use in clinical settings contribute to its extensive adoption.
  • By application, radiology/general imaging holds the largest market share as elastography is widely used for diagnosing various conditions, including liver diseases, breast lesions, and thyroid abnormalities. Its non-invasive nature and ability to improve diagnostic accuracy have driven its widespread integration into general imaging practices.
  • By region, North America stands as the leading region in the elastography imaging market. This leadership is driven by a well-established healthcare infrastructure, widespread adoption of advanced imaging technologies, and significant investments in research and development. 
  • Asia Pacific is experiencing the fastest market growth. This rapid expansion is fueled by an increasing geriatric population, rising prevalence of chronic diseases, and improvements in healthcare services.
